Pecan Parmesan Chicken

Elevate your weeknight dinner game with this irresistible Pecan Parmesan Chicken recipe! Juicy, tender chicken breasts are coated in a flavorful crust made from finely ground pecans and Parmesan cheese, delivering a crispy, nutty exterior with a hint of savory richness. Lightly seasoned with garlic powder, paprika, and black pepper, these chicken cutlets are pan-seared to golden perfection before finishing in the oven to lock in their moisture. Perfect for both busy weeknights and special occasions, this easy meal comes together in just 35 minutes. Serve it alongside mashed potatoes, steamed vegetables, or a crisp salad for a wholesome and satisfying dinner. Packed with texture, flavor, and protein, this Pecan Parmesan Chicken is sure to become a family favorite!

Prep Time:15 mins
Cook Time:20 mins
Total Time:35 mins
Servings: 4

Ingredients

  • 4 pieces boneless, skinless chicken breasts
  • 1 cup pecans
  • 0.5 cup Parmesan cheese, grated
  • 0.5 cup all-purpose flour
  • 2 large eggs
  • 2 tablespoons milk
  • 1 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1 teaspoon paprika
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 0.5 teaspoon black pepper
  • 3 tablespoons olive oil or neutral frying oil
  • 2 tablespoons fresh parsley (optional, for garnish)

Directions

Step 1

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C).

Step 2

Place the pecans in a food processor and pulse until finely ground. Transfer to a bowl and mix with the grated Parmesan cheese. Set aside.

Step 3

In a separate shallow dish, combine the flour, garlic powder, paprika, salt, and black pepper.

Step 4

In another shallow dish, whisk together the eggs and milk until well combined.

Step 5

Pound the chicken breasts to an even thickness using a meat mallet or rolling pin, about 1/2 inch thick. This helps to ensure even cooking.

Step 6

Dredge each chicken breast in the seasoned flour, shaking off the excess.

Step 7

Dip the floured chicken into the egg mixture, coating it fully and allowing the excess to drip off.

Step 8

Press the chicken into the pecan-Parmesan mixture, ensuring it is evenly coated on both sides.

Step 9

Heat the olive oil in a large oven-safe skillet over medium heat. Once hot, add the chicken breasts and cook for 3-4 minutes per side until golden brown.

Step 10

Transfer the skillet to the preheated oven and bake for 10-12 minutes, or until the chicken's internal temperature reaches 165°F (74°C).

Step 11

Remove from the oven and let the chicken rest for 5 minutes before serving.

Step 12

Optional: Garnish with freshly chopped parsley for a pop of color and added freshness.

Step 13

Serve warm with your choice of sides, such as mashed potatoes, steamed vegetables, or a fresh salad.
